Where does “ชาชัก” come from?
ชาชัก (Thai) comes from Thai ชา, from Proto-Tai ɟaːᴬ, from Middle Chinese 茶, from Chinese 茶, from Proto-Loloish la¹, from Proto-Sino-Tibetan s-la — leaf; tea; flat object.
ชาชัก (Thai): teh tarik

Ancestry of “ชาชัก”, step by step
ชาชัก traces back through two separate lines of ancestry.
via Thai ชา
| Step | Language | Word | Meaning |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Thai | ชา | numb; tea |
| 2 | Proto-Tai | ɟaːᴬ | tea |
| 3 | Middle Chinese | 茶 | — |
| 4 | Chinese | 茶 | tea |
| 5 | Proto-Loloish | la¹ | tea |
| 6 | Proto-Sino-Tibetan | s-la | leaf; tea; flat object |
via Thai ชัก
| Step | Language | Word | Meaning |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Thai | ชัก | to pull, draw, or drag; to deduct; to subtract;... |
